Factors Influencing Computer Prices in 2025
Several key elements are expected to influence the pricing trends of computers in 2025. Understanding these factors can provide insight into whether prices will rise or stabilize.
Supply Chain Dynamics
The supply chain remains a critical component in determining computer prices. Although improvements have been made since the disruptions caused by the COVID-19 pandemic, certain challenges persist:
- Semiconductor shortages continue to affect the availability of essential components.
- Logistic delays and increased shipping costs add to the overall production expenses.
- Geopolitical tensions, especially involving major chip-producing countries, may cause periodic supply interruptions.
Technological Advancements
New technologies often lead to price fluctuations. Innovations such as advanced processors, new GPU architectures, and enhanced memory types impact costs:
- Cutting-edge components typically command a premium at launch.
- Over time, production efficiencies and competition tend to reduce prices.
- The integration of AI capabilities and energy-efficient designs may increase initial costs but offer long-term value.
Market Demand and Consumer Preferences
Demand patterns significantly influence pricing strategies. Factors affecting demand include:
- Increased remote work and education driving higher demand for laptops and desktops.
- Growing interest in gaming and content creation fueling demand for high-performance machines.
- Shift towards lightweight, portable devices may encourage manufacturers to price premium ultrabooks higher.
Economic Conditions
Global economic trends also affect computer prices:
- Inflationary pressures can increase manufacturing and retail costs.
- Currency fluctuations impact international pricing strategies.
- Changes in tariffs and trade policies may add to import/export costs.

Impact of Emerging Technologies on Pricing
Emerging technologies are shaping the future cost structure of computers. Key innovations include:
- Artificial Intelligence Integration: AI-powered features require specialized chips and software optimizations, which may increase upfront costs but enhance user experience and efficiency.
- Quantum Computing Research: While still in early stages, advancements in quantum technologies could eventually influence pricing by driving new industry standards and demand for hybrid computing solutions.
- Sustainability Initiatives: Manufacturers are increasingly adopting eco-friendly materials and energy-efficient designs. These efforts might raise production costs initially but can lead to long-term savings and regulatory benefits.
- Modular and Upgradeable Designs: There is a growing trend towards modular computers that allow users to upgrade components easily. This approach may distribute costs over time rather than requiring significant upfront investment.
Strategies for Consumers to Manage Costs
Consumers can adopt various strategies to mitigate the impact of potential price increases:
- Timing Purchases: Buying during promotional periods or just after product launches can help secure better deals.
- Prioritizing Needs: Focusing on essential features rather than the latest technology can reduce unnecessary expenses.
- Considering Refurbished Models: Certified refurbished computers offer cost savings without significant compromises in quality.
- Exploring Financing Options: Payment plans or trade-in programs can make higher-priced models more accessible.
- Monitoring Market Trends: Staying informed about upcoming releases and industry news enables smarter purchasing decisions.

Impact of Inflation and Economic Outlook on Computer Prices
Inflation remains a significant factor in projecting computer prices for 2025. The following points summarize how inflation and the broader economic environment may impact computer hardware costs:
- Component Manufacturing Costs: Rising raw material prices and wages increase the cost base for manufacturers, often passed on to consumers.
- Currency Fluctuations: Exchange rate volatility can affect import costs, particularly for components sourced internationally.
- Consumer Spending Power: Economic slowdowns or recessions may dampen demand, potentially limiting price increases.
- Monetary Policy: Central banks’ interest rate decisions to control inflation indirectly impact consumer electronics pricing by influencing cost of capital and financing.
Role of Innovation and Market Competition in Price Setting
Technological innovation and competitive dynamics among manufacturers also play a crucial role in determining computer prices:
- Competition Among Vendors: Intense rivalry among major PC makers and component suppliers encourages competitive pricing to capture market share.
- Product Differentiation: Innovative features, such as AI integration, better display technology, or enhanced security, may justify premium pricing.
- Economies of Scale: As new technologies become mainstream, production scale typically reduces unit costs, which can help stabilize or reduce prices.
